PINION DEPTH ADJUSTMENT

Tools Required

J 36601 Pinion Shim Selector. See Special Tools.

J 29763 Static Timing Gage. See Special Tools.

Adjustment

1. Install the pinion bearing cups into the differential carrier assembly. Refer to Front

Differential Drive Pinion Gear Bearing Cup Installation (9.25 Inch Axle w/J 45754)
or Front Differential Drive Pinion Gear Bearing Cup Installation (8.25 Inch Axle w/J
45858)
or Front Differential Drive Pinion Gear Bearing Cup Installation (8.25/9.25
Inch Axles w/J 36598)
.

2. Before assembly, lubricate the pinion bearings with axle lubricant. Use the correct fluid.

Refer to Sealers, Adhesives, and Lubricants.

IMPORTANT: Make sure all of the tools, the pinion bearings, and the pinion

bearing cups are clean before proceeding.

2008 Chevrolet Silverado 1500

2008 Driveline/Axle Front Drive Axle - Cab & Chassis Sierra, Cab & Chassis Silverado, Sierra & Silverado

Fig. 198: Using J 36601-7, J 36601-5, J 21777-8 & J 36601-3 To Adjust Pinion Depth
Courtesy of GENERAL MOTORS CORP.

3. Install the J 36601-4 or the J 36601-3 (4) to the J 36601-7 (1).

4. Install the J 21777-35 for the 8.25 inch axle or the J 21777-8 for the 9.25 inch axle (3) to

the J 36601-7 (1).

5. Install the inner pinion bearing into the differential carrier case half.

IMPORTANT: The J 36601 uses two different measuring arms to measure

the pinion depth. See Special Tools. The J 36601-4 is used to
measure the pinion depth for the 8.25 inch axle and the J
36601-3 is used to measure the pinion depth for the 9.25 inch
axle.

2008 Chevrolet Silverado 1500

2008 Driveline/Axle Front Drive Axle - Cab & Chassis Sierra, Cab & Chassis Silverado, Sierra & Silverado

6. Insert the J 36601-7 (1) with the J 21777-35 or the J 21777-8 (3) through the inner pinion

bearing and the differential carrier case half.

7. Install the outer pinion bearing.

8. While holding the outer pinion bearing in position, install the J 36601-5 (2), the washer, and

the nut to the J 36601-7 (1).

9. While holding the J 36601-7 (1) stationary with a wrench, tighten the nut on the J 36601-7

(1).

Tighten: Tighten the nut until all of the end play is removed from the J 36601 . See
Special Tools.

10. Rotate the assembly several times in both directions in order to seat the pinion bearings.

11. While holding the J 36601-4 or the J 36601-3 (4) stationary, measure the rotating torque of

the J 36601 using an inch-pound torque wrench. See Special Tools.

Specification: The rotating torque of the J 36601 should be between 1. See Special
Tools
.1-2.3 N.m (10-20 lb in).

12. If the torque is less than 1.0 N.m (10 lb in), continue to tighten the nut on the J 36601-7

until a rotating torque of 1.1-2.3 N.m (10-20 lb in) is obtained.

IMPORTANT: Each end of the J 36601-5 is sized specifically for the 8.25

inch or the 9.25 inch outer pinion bearing. Ensure the correct
end is being used when installing the J 36601-5 into the outer
pinion bearing.
